Transaction e40b5783fba0865896cf947fe7c7ec3797a118bf41013acb6e0928314930a0e1
1 Input
1 Output
-
e40b5783fba0865896cf947fe7c7ec3797a118bf41013acb6e0928314930a0e1:0
- value
- 293539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0038397531c998d0b4ac0bf141001f6a1c8a2e1a OP_EQUAL
- address
- 31iBH5yisxkdGtvhjcmjEmBoHnEiVse44r